Output 6611612ac74c128572e62604f52e5c48b6eb7644f6c9c4873b9e84eedad2a68e:1

value
5395046
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b6770af1612bd7b71f75cf19cba327f3d96a2395 OP_EQUALVERIFY OP_CHECKSIG
address
1Hdnb9bEuYfp1Q7cNhjxU86n15S4h7MSup
transaction
6611612ac74c128572e62604f52e5c48b6eb7644f6c9c4873b9e84eedad2a68e
spent
true